The 3rd Annual Summer Jazz Workshop, now in partnership with San Diego’s House of Blues® and Jazz 88.3, provides a unique opportunity for middle and high school age students to study with some of San Diego's most gifted professional jazz musicians/teachers in an environment designed to nurture their growth as musicians, both technically and creatively. This is a hands-on Workshop where students learn performance skills, improvisation, jazz theory and history, with the emphasis on playing music! Three, one-week sessions will be held at Francis Parker School's Thiemann Music Center, a state-of-the-art facility featuring dedicated classrooms and practice studios. This is the perfect venue for students to grow musically as they learn to express themselves through the art of jazz improvisation. Each session culminates with the opportunity for the students to perform at one of San Diego's premier concert venues, the House of Blues®.
